Crowne Plaza Greater Noida has announced the launch of an all-new menu at Spice Art, its signature Indian fine dining restaurant, bringing guests an immersive culinary experience inspired by the timeless flavours of Awadhi and Mughlai cuisine.

Curated by Chef Vijay, the refreshed menu celebrates the grandeur of India’s royal kitchens while presenting traditional recipes through a contemporary fine dining approach. The new offerings highlight authentic regional flavours, handcrafted spice blends, and refined culinary techniques, creating an elevated gastronomic journey for guests.

Known for its elegant ambience and soulful live ghazal performances, Spice Art continues its celebration of Indian culinary heritage with dishes inspired by the royal cuisines of Punjab, Delhi, and Lucknow.

The culinary experience begins with an extensive selection of starters, including Dahi Ke Kebab, Bhuna Masala Paneer Tikka, Badami Murgh Chandi Kebab, and Nimbu Neem Ki Tawa Fish, followed by comforting soups such as Tamatar Chakunder Shorba and Murgh Pudina Ka Ark.

The main course showcases the richness of Indian royal cuisine with signature dishes including Dal Spice Art, Martaban Ka Paneer, Subz Panchratan Masala, Nawabi Pasanda, Chaap-e-Awadh, Nalli Nihari, Dilli-6 Murgh Korma, Murgh Tikka Makhan Masala, Sarson Wali Macchi, and Saunfyani Kadhai Jhinga.

Highlighting traditional cooking techniques, the Murgh Tikka Makhan Masala features char-grilled chicken tikka prepared in a rich buttery tomato gravy, while Sarson Wali Macchi brings together mustard-marinated river sole with aromatic Indian spices. The Saunfyani Kadhai Jhinga combines succulent prawns with fennel and traditional spice flavours.

The menu also features aromatic biryanis including Murgh Dum Biryani, Lucknowi Gosht Biryani, and Subz Dum Biryani, paired with freshly baked Indian breads such as Roghni Naan, Sheermal, and Amritsari Kulcha. Guests can end their meal with classic desserts including Khubani Ka Meetha and Shahi Meetha.

Enhancing the dining experience, Spice Art has introduced handcrafted mocktails inspired by Indian flavours. Mehmaan Nawazi, featuring orange juice, sweet peach, and a subtle hint of house-made pickle, celebrates India's tradition of hospitality, while Jamun Jashn combines jamun, basil, lavender, black salt, and Sprite for a refreshing seasonal beverage.
